A provisional patent application is a bit of a misnomer because it will not provide you with a patent, but what it will provide you with is a priority date. After you have made a provisional patent application you have one year to apply for a full patent. If you fail to make this full application after one year then all the ...Jan 13, 2024 · It is impossible to directly search provisional patents online because provisional patents are never published (see Advantages and Disadvantages page).). Furthermore, viewing a provisional patent would not give you much information because it has not yet gone through the entire patent process and you would not know what the final claims are. The provisional patent application is only pending for 12 months prior to becoming abandoned. Thus, filing a non-provisional patent application claiming the benefit of the provisional application must be done within 12 months. ... The non-electronic filing fee does not apply to design, plant, or provisional applications. ...Yes. An applicant can file as many provisional applications as desired for a single invention during the one year “life span” of the first provisional application. Advertisement So you're an inventor and you've recently come up with a new way of repelling bear...A provisional patent application cannot be renewed or extended. A provisional patent lasts for 12 months and to keep the filing date of the provisional patent, you must file a non-provisional patent application before the 12 months are up.
